- Belvedere Museum - Schloss Belvedere is a historic baroque palace complex in Vienna, Austria, featuring two stunning palaces (the Upper and Lower Belvedere) nestled in a picturesque park. Constructed in the early 18th century as a summer residence for Prince Eugene of Savoy, it now hosts the Belvedere Museum, famous for its vast collection of Austrian and international art.
- Prater - Prater Park in Vienna, Austria, is a sprawling public park celebrated for its expansive green areas, woodlands, and the iconic Wiener Riesenrad Ferris wheel. It provides a range of recreational activities, including amusement park rides, sports facilities, and trails for walking and cycling, making it a favored spot for both locals and visitors.

- Ringstrasse - The Ringstraße is a magnificent boulevard encircling Vienna’s historic city center, noted for its luxurious buildings, monuments, and parks from the 19th century. It houses some of Vienna’s most important architectural, cultural, and historical landmarks, including the Vienna State Opera, the Hofburg Palace, and the Austrian Parliament Building.
- Hundertwasserhaus - The Hundertwasserhaus in Vienna is a vividly colored, unique apartment building designed by Austrian artist Friedensreich Hundertwasser. Its remarkable features include uneven floors, a roof covered with earth and grass, and large trees growing from within the rooms, all challenging traditional architectural norms and celebrating a harmonious integration of nature and human living.
